Clinical governance stands as the vigilant guardian of evidence-based healthcare, orchestrating a symphony of practices to ensure optimal patient outcomes. It encapsulates a comprehensive framework integrating evidence, risk management, and quality improvement, crafting a robust system for delivering the highest standards of care.
In the realm of evidence-based clinical governance, decision-making becomes a finely tuned instrument, harmonizing the latest evidence, clinical expertise, and patient values. This dynamic integration not only upholds established standards but also propels healthcare professionals towards adaptability, encouraging a perpetual evolution of practices based on emerging evidence.
Embracing evidence-based clinical governance is akin to cultivating a culture of perpetual improvement and forward-thinking within healthcare organizations. Regular audits, feedback loops, and the integration of cutting-edge research into protocols become the norm, ensuring that the provision of care resonates with the pulse of medical progress.
